Hospital Day at the Legislature is an annual event bringing hospital leaders and health care professionals from across West Virginia together with state lawmakers to discuss issues impacting hospitals and patient care statewide.

This year’s event is set for Thursday, February 12, 2026 and will take place at the West Virginia State Capitol Complex in Charleston, WV.

Hospital and health system leaders, health care professionals, hospital advocates and members of the West Virginia Legislature will be in attendance.

Hospital representatives from across the state will meet with legislators to highlight the vital role hospitals play in providing lifesaving care, supporting local economies and ensuring access to care for all communities across West Virginia.

Discussions will focus on key issues impacting hospitals and the patients they serve, including:

  • Access to care and hospital financial viability
  • Regulatory, administrative and operational processes
  • Health care workforce challenges
  • Community health needs

Hospitals remain one of West Virginia’s largest employment sectors, generating approximately $16.9 billion in economic impact statewide. Hospital Day at the Legislature ensures policymakers hear directly from hospital leaders about the challenges and opportunities facing the state’s health care delivery system.

“Hospital Day at the Legislature provides a special opportunity for health care providers across our state to engage directly with lawmakers and ensure their voices are heard,” says Jim Kaufman, West Virginia Hospital Association president and CEO. “As hospitals face critical challenges—from federal policy changes that could fundamentally reshape health care financing to workforce shortages and regulatory burdens—it is more important than ever for legislators to understand how their decisions affect hospitals’ ability to care for and serve their communities.”
